Olympus SZ-12 vs Panasonic FX90 Overview

In this write-up, we are evaluating the Olympus SZ-12 and Panasonic FX90, former being a Small Sensor Superzoom while the other is a Small Sensor Compact by companies Olympus and Panasonic. The sensor resolution of the SZ-12 (14MP) and the FX90 (12MP) is fairly similar and they use the same exact sensor size (1/2.3").

Olympus SZ-12 vs Panasonic FX90 Physical Comparison

For those who are looking to carry your camera frequently, you will want to consider its weight and dimensions. The Olympus SZ-12 has got exterior measurements of 106mm x 69mm x 40mm (4.2" x 2.7" x 1.6") and a weight of 226 grams (0.50 lbs) and the Panasonic FX90 has dimensions of 102mm x 56mm x 22mm (4.0" x 2.2" x 0.9") and a weight of 149 grams (0.33 lbs).

Olympus SZ-12 vs Panasonic FX90 Sensor Comparison

More often than not, it is very tough to see the gap between sensor sizing just by reviewing technical specs. The graphic underneath will offer you a clearer sense of the sensor measurements in the SZ-12 and FX90.

As you have seen, both the cameras offer the same exact sensor sizing but not the same megapixels. You can anticipate the Olympus SZ-12 to offer you greater detail as a result of its extra 2MP. Greater resolution will help you crop photos a little more aggressively.
